Ventilation Range hoods are designed to enhance kitchen ventilation by drawing out smoke, grease, and smells created during cooking. They can likewise filter airborne pollutants that are hazardous to your health, such as carbon monoxide and cigarette smoke. Ventilation systems vary depending upon the design and layout of your home, the position of your range, and whether you choose a ducted or ductless design. Wall-mounted range hoods, which are installed versus your wall, vent up utilizing ductwork that runs through the wall and outside your home, while island install range hoods are suspended from your ceiling above an island or peninsula cooktop or oven. Sound There's a great deal of sound in a kitchen, from chattering cooks to the timer letting you understand your food is ready. While a few of this sound is pleasant (as is the sound of sauces simmering), there are other sounds that are not— like rattling and banging from your range hood throughout strong winds. This type of sound normally occurs when the damper or dampers on your hood cap are not closing effectively. This can be repaired by analyzing the dampers and tightening up loose screws. If essential, you can likewise include weight to the damper to prevent it from flapping in the wind. Another common cause of rattling and banging is the existence of blockages or blocked filters. Cleaning or changing these products can significantly minimize the quantity of sound your hood produces. A faulty motor or a fan that is operating at an insufficient speed can also produce noisy outcomes. It is crucial to have actually these parts examined by an expert, so that any problems can be fixed rapidly and safely. Finally, the ducting that brings air from your hood to outside can likewise be the source of noise. This can be an outcome of a bad fit, obstructing, or an unsuitable size of the venting system. If this holds true, you will need to have it changed or resized. If you are not delighted with the sound level of your range hood, you can try various settings to find the perfect balance in between suction power and noise control. You can likewise use multispeed settings to enable the hood to run at lower speeds, which are less likely to produce noise. In addition, you can add a hold-up shut-off function to your hood that will shut down the hood after a set amount of time. While there are a variety of ways you can lower the amount of noise that your range hood produces, keep in mind that any appliance that efficiently gets rid of smoke, smells, and grease from the air is going to make some quantity of sound. The very best way to minimize this is to ensure that your hood is installed correctly which the ductwork is effectively routed to outside. Among the most important factors to consider when choosing a kitchen ventilation hood is its CFM rating, which determines the amount of air it can extract and vent per hour. The greater the number, the more powerful the hood. A high CFM rating is necessary if you plan to cook in the kitchen frequently, or if your kitchen has a big opening that opens into other rooms. Another factor to consider when picking a kitchen ventilation hood is its sound level, which is measured in sones. A higher sone score means a louder hood, which can impact your kitchen's total sound quality. If you reside in a quiet location, or if your kitchen lies in an open-plan home, a low noise level is preferred.
